On 31st August 1888, Mary Ann Nichols was found brutally murdered in Whitechapel β and with her death, the shadow of Jack the Ripper began to fall across London.
In this episode of Macabre London, we take you inside the police investigation into the first confirmed Ripper murder. How did officers approach the scene? What evidence did they have to work with in Victorian London? And could they have stopped the Ripper before his killing spree claimed more lives?
Using contemporary police reports, witness statements, and historical accounts, weβll explore the exact steps the Metropolitan Police took β and the mistakes that might have changed history.
